The Terminator Saga: Evolution and Impact

Linda Hamilton’s portrayal of Sarah Connor has been revolutionary. Initially, when “The Terminator” was released in 1984, the idea of a woman in a leading action role was unconventional. However, Hamilton’s compelling performance broke barriers, showcasing a fierce and determined protagonist in a genre dominated by male leads. The success of the film not only elevated her status in Hollywood but also paved the way for more complex female characters in action films. Her portrayal of Sarah Connor went beyond physical action; it incorporated emotional depth, making it relatable and inspiring for a broader audience.

When “Terminator 2: Judgment Day” was released in 1991, Hamilton reprised her role to acclaim, demonstrating her versatility and commitment to challenging roles. This film’s commercial and critical success further cemented her legacy in action cinema. Notably, Hamilton’s performances in the “Terminator” series have been analyzed for their impact on gender roles in film, marking a significant shift in how female action heroes are portrayed.

Returning to the Fray: Navigating a Career Comeback

Decades after her initial breakout role, Linda Hamilton made a compelling return with “Terminator: Dark Fate” in 2019. By this time, the landscape of action films had drastically changed, with a greater emphasis on CGI and younger lead actors. Yet, Hamilton’s decision to return at an older age was met with mixed reviews. Her comeback, however, provides an insightful perspective on industry trends and audience expectations.

Hamilton’s choice to return demonstrated both her resilience and the industry’s evolving standards. “Terminator: Dark Fate” was a commercial success, indicating that there is still a strong audience demand for her iconic character. This comeback also underlines the importance of adapting to changes in the industry while maintaining personal and professional relevance.
